The Sun Shines to Everyone (1959) is a Drama / Romance film directed by Konstantin Voinov, starring Valentin Zubkov, Liliya Aleshnikova, Evgeni Burenkov.

DramaRomance

Overview

Czechoslovakia, May 9, 1945. The end of the war has already been announced. Nikolai Savelyev dreams of returning to his hometown and teaching children history again. Suddenly a battle begins - the SS unit is trying to break through to the west. The battery commander chickened out and fled. Savelyev takes command. He receives a serious injury that leads to blindness. He is accompanied to his hometown by nurse Svetlana. Nikolai does not immediately manage to find his place in life...
